E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ases the Resurrection of Lazarus, a stunning mural mosaic found at the church of Saint Apollinar in Ravenna. Created by the Byzantine School in the 6th century, this masterpiece is a testament to both artistic brilliance and religious devotion. The image transports us to Sant Apollinare Nuovo in Ravenna, Italy, where this awe-inspiring artwork resides. The Resurrection of Lazarus depicts a biblical miracle performed by Jesus Christ himself. It captures the moment when Lazarus rises from his tomb after being dead for four days, symbolizing resurrection and eternal life.
